Future In Sight, located in Concord, New Hampshire, and founded in 1912 as the New
Hampshire Association for the Blind, is the only private nonprofit
organization in New Hampshire to supply a comprehensive range of statewide
services to children, adults, and elderly who are living with vision loss and
blindness. We have remained steadfast in our mission over the last 111
years: to advance the independence of persons who are blind and visually
impaired. Our Vision? We imagine an inclusive world where every person who is

Our services are available to individuals who
have begun to lose – or have completely lost – their vision due to trauma,
disease, and the natural progression of age. Services and support are provided through Future In Sight to any individual living with a severe vision disability, regardless of their ability to pay. Future In Sight, established as the New Hampshire Association for the Blind in 1912, is the only statewide nonprofit that provides specialized services and support that meet the range of needs that individuals of all ages and stages of vision loss experience at home, at school, and in the community – including via online learning and telehealth channels.
In highly visual world, having a visual impairment can have a far-reaching effect on all aspects of life. From a child’s early development, teens’ preparation for the workforce, adults’ career adaptations, to seniors’ safety, independence, and mental health, building connections, accessing training and support are all critical drivers of overall health and well-being. Both our Youth Services and Adult Services teams address the holistic needs of the person served through 1:1 training and group social/recreational activities, peer support and technology user groups. Increasingly, advances and affordability of technology in the marketplace enable greater accessibility for individuals who are blind or visually impaired; our staff integrates those tools into the education and training they provide. Together with the students’ and clients’ hard work and determination, we work to deliver services that yield lasting outcomes, so that they thrive during life’s changing circumstances — and we do not deny anyone services based on their financial capacity.
